基于镜像和基于文件的备份比较

在當今的數據保護環境中,有許多備份類型可用來保護您的數據。當涉及到對單獨文件進行備份時,許多組織依賴於基於文件的備份和文件同步解決方案,例如 Dropbox、Google Drive 和 OneDrive。然而,它們並不是最佳選擇,因為這些類型的解決方案無法確保在數據丟失或損壞的情況下進行數據恢復。

基於影像的備份是一種針對當今商業 IT 基礎設施設計的現代備份方法。它為整個操作系統提供全面的數據保護,包括文件和其他應用程序數據,並簡化了恢復過程。

影像備份和基於文件的備份用於實現不同的目標。儘管有些人可能認為這兩種方法可以互換使用,但對每種方法的良好理解可以幫助加強組織的數據保護策略。本文詳細介紹了這兩種方法之間的相似之處和差異。

什麼是基於文件的備份?

基於文件的備份是單個文件和文件夾的副本。此備份方法在文件系統級別運行,以處理源文件。當您生成和存儲相對較少的數據,特別是如果這些數據是跨平台的時候,基於文件的備份效果很好。

然而,要執行基於文件的備份,通常需要在源計算機上安裝一個稱為代理的軟件,並在目標主機(無論是家用 PC 還是雲中的服務器)上安裝另一個副本的代理。

當您需要備份完整系統,例如整個操作系統或虛擬機器時,基於文件的備份是不夠的。操作系統,無論是安裝在物理機器上還是虛擬機器上,都比單純的一組文件更加複雜。操作系統包含許多正在運行的操作,如存儲在RAM中的數據或輸入和輸出操作。

注意: 從技術上講,使用基於文件的備份方法可以備份操作系統,因為OS的配置存儲在文件中。但是,在您複製一個文件的內容時,另一個文件可能已更改。因此,即使從源VM複製了所有文件,備份也不會是崩潰一致的,這會使後續的恢復過程變得復雜。

當涉及到操作系統和虛擬機器的備份時,基於映像的備份是更好且更可靠的選擇。讓我們更仔細地看看基於映像的備份。

什麼是基於映像的備份?

基於映像的備份是將整個虛擬機器或物理機器以及操作系統、配置文件和系統狀態一起備份的過程。整個備份被保存為一個稱為映像的文件。

這份備份被認為是崩潰一致的,因為所有的資料都是在完全相同的時間點取得,依賴微軟的卷影複製(VSS)在卷級別上運行(針對基於Windows的作業系統)。基於映像的備份也可以用於創建應用一致的備份,以簡化在Microsoft Exchange Server、SQL Server、Active Directory等應用程序中的數據恢復。您可以在我們關於崩潰一致備份與應用一致備份的文章中找到更多信息。

目前,大多數基於映像的解決方案對於虛擬機器是無代理的,儘管備份物理機器需要使用代理。大多數虛擬化解決方案都有一個內建的機制來拍攝快照(在Hyper-V中也稱為檢查點)。因此,備份應用程序通常使用這些內部服務所生成的快照。讓我們更仔細地看看基於映像的備份是如何創建的。

基於映像的備份如何創建

創建基於映像的備份需要以下步驟:

  1. 在備份開始之前,備份應用程序會觸發創建虛擬機器的磁盤文件的快照。這意味著狀態和操作在特定時間點被凍結。虛擬機器磁盤切換到只讀模式,而在此期間對這些磁盤進行的任何更改都將寫入增量文件。
  2. 在創建快照後,備份應用程序將數據從只讀文件複製到備份存儲庫,而源系統繼續運行。
  3. 一旦備份創建完成,增量文件將合併到虛擬機磁盤中,虛擬機磁盤將恢復正常的寫操作。快照將被刪除。

基於映像的備份的優勢

  • 完整機器恢復:恢復完整機器及其操作系統和配置,立即使用。
  • 文件和應用對象的即時恢復:立即恢復不同項目至其所需位置,以立即恢復工作流程。
  • 支持重複刪除和其他節省空間的功能
  • 數據保護的集中管理:基於映像的備份解決方案支持從單一操作介面對不同類型的IT基礎設施進行備份和恢復。
  • 自動化和編排功能:能夠自動執行常規數據保護活動並創建自動化的任務序列。

使用NAKIVO備份與複製的基於映像的備份

NAKIVO備份與複製允許您對Hyper-V、VMware和Nutanix AHV虛擬機器;Amazon EC2實例;以及Linux和Windows物理伺服器和工作站執行基於映像的、應用感知的備份。

下載NAKIVO解決方案的免費版本,以查看所有先進工具和功能,幫助您確保數據可恢復性和業務連續性。

Source:
https://www.nakivo.com/blog/image-based-vs-file-based-backup/